
TinCaps Game Notes: May 29 vs. West Michigan (Game 48)
Published on May 29, 2015 under Midwest League (MWL1)
Fort Wayne TinCaps News Release
Fort Wayne TinCaps (18-29) vs. West Michigan Whitecaps (25-23)
RHP Dinelson Lamet (0-3, 4.68) vs. RHP Spenser Watkins (0-0, 0.00)
Friday, May 29, 2015 - Parkview Field - First Pitch 7:05 p.m. - Game 48
LISTEN: ESPN Radio 1380 (WKJG) / TinCaps.com / TuneIn Radio App
WATCH: Comcast Network 81
ABOUT LAST NIGHT: The TinCaps had superb pitching on Thursday night at Parkview Field, but came away with a pair of 1-run losses against the Great Lakes Loons in a doubleheader. Fort Wayne fell 1-0 in the front-end and 2-1 in the finale.
ROSTER MOVE: The Padres have reinstated right-hander Dinelson Lamet to the Fort Wayne roster after he went on the Disabled List on May 20. With the return of Lamet as he starts tonight, left-hander Taylor Cox has been sent back to Extended Spring Training.
MAKING MOVES: In the month of April, the Padres only made 1 change to Fort Wayne's roster (adding infielder Nick Vilter when Josh VanMeter went on the Disabled List). In May, San Diego has brought 9 new faces to the TinCaps.
STARTING STRONG: During their five-game series with Great Lakes (in which they went 3-2), TinCaps starting pitchers worked 28 innings and allowed only 5 earned runs. That equates to a 1.61 ERA. In Game 1 Thursday, Chris Huffman gave up only 1 unearned run in 6 1/3 innings. Then in Game 2, Jose Castillo tossed 5 scoreless.
LEGO NIGHT: TinCaps are wearing special LEGO-themed jerseys which are being auctioned off in the ballpark and online at TinCapsJerseys.com. Proceeds from the auction will benefit Little People Matter, a non-profit organization that raises money for the 4,000 children in the world who die each day due to a lack of access to clean water. THE OTHER GUYS: West Michigan's roster features the following Top 30 Detroit Tigers prospects according to MLB.com: No. 2 Derek Hill (OF), No. 6 Spencer Turnbull (RHP), No. 11 Joe Jimenez (RHP), No. 12 Artie Lewicki (RHP)*, No. 18 Adam Ravenelle (RHP)*, No. 21 Joey Pankake (INF), No. 22 Shane Zeile (C), No. 25 Zach Shepherd (INF), No. 30 Michael Gerber (OF).
* Disabled List
